I am using Gambas 2.8.2-1ubuntu1.

I wrote a program that randomly displays a line from a text file. The code worked in pure Gambas but then I tried to improve it! (Ho Ho Ho)

I searched around and I came up with and modified an executable BASH script (test.sh) that worked substantially faster than my code so I tried to incorporate it into the source code.

During my testing I continuously ran tests in a terminal and everything worked perfectly with the script. I tried it in my code using

## EXEC ["~/test.sh"] to sOutPut or EXEC ["~/./test.sh"] to sOutPut

and nothing worked. sOutPut was always "".

The attached tar file contained a small program that contains an example EXEC problem code. A modified test.sh script is included along with a dummy data file, words.txt.

Any ideas about the EXEC problem?
